public class

ReportExportExcelFormatTransform

extends AbstractReportExportTransform
java.lang.Object
   ↳ com.microstrategy.web.transform.AbstractTransform
     ↳ com.microstrategy.web.transform.AbstractLayoutTransform
       ↳ com.microstrategy.web.app.transforms.AbstractAppTransform
         ↳ com.microstrategy.web.app.transforms.AbstractWebBeanTransform
           ↳ com.microstrategy.web.app.transforms.AbstractReportTransform
             ↳ com.microstrategy.web.app.transforms.AbstractReportExportTransform
               ↳ com.microstrategy.web.app.transforms.ReportExportExcelFormatTransform

Summary

[Expand]
Inherited Constants
From class com.microstrategy.web.app.transforms.AbstractAppTransform
Fields
protected FormalParameter enableExcelNumFormat This formal parameter determines whether to enable number formatting for Excel.
protected FormalParameter enableExcelOutline This formal parameter determines whether to export outline reports as outline in Excel.
[Expand]
Inherited Fields
From class com.microstrategy.web.app.transforms.AbstractReportExportTransform
From class com.microstrategy.web.app.transforms.AbstractReportTransform
From class com.microstrategy.web.app.transforms.AbstractAppTransform
Public Constructors
ReportExportExcelFormatTransform()
Public Methods
Map getAttributesHTML()
Gets the list of html attributes for the html tag
void initializeProperties()
Initialize some properties for the transform.
void renderExcelHeader(MarkupOutput mo)
Renders a header to tell Excel to display the headers on top for outline mode reports
void renderLinesBetweenGridAndGraph(MarkupOutput mo)
Protected Methods
void initFormalParasForGraphTransform(TransformInstance ti)
void initFormalParasForGridTransform(TransformInstance ti)
void initFormalParasForPageByTransform(TransformInstance ti)
[Expand]
Inherited Methods
From class com.microstrategy.web.app.transforms.AbstractReportExportTransform
From class com.microstrategy.web.app.transforms.AbstractReportTransform
From class com.microstrategy.web.app.transforms.AbstractWebBeanTransform
From class com.microstrategy.web.app.transforms.AbstractAppTransform
From class com.microstrategy.web.transform.AbstractLayoutTransform
From class com.microstrategy.web.transform.AbstractTransform
From class java.lang.Object
From interface com.microstrategy.web.app.transforms.AppTransform
From interface com.microstrategy.web.transform.LayoutTransform
From interface com.microstrategy.web.transform.Transform

Fields

protected FormalParameter enableExcelNumFormat

This formal parameter determines whether to enable number formatting for Excel. Allowed Values: TRUE/FALSE.

protected FormalParameter enableExcelOutline

This formal parameter determines whether to export outline reports as outline in Excel. This feature depends on the getRawDataEnabled() property of the ExportBean Allowed Values: TRUE/FALSE.

Public Constructors

public ReportExportExcelFormatTransform ()

Public Methods

public Map getAttributesHTML ()

Gets the list of html attributes for the html tag

public void initializeProperties ()

Initialize some properties for the transform.
For example, it may overwrite some formal parameters' values depending on whether the corresponding feature is available.

public void renderExcelHeader (MarkupOutput mo)

Renders a header to tell Excel to display the headers on top for outline mode reports

Parameters
mo MarkupOutput

public void renderLinesBetweenGridAndGraph (MarkupOutput mo)

Protected Methods

protected void initFormalParasForGraphTransform (TransformInstance ti)

protected void initFormalParasForGridTransform (TransformInstance ti)

protected void initFormalParasForPageByTransform (TransformInstance ti)